Output 621f7c0583a4a429a7665e0a9cd2a10837808da2c6ea75b65de15c0ed2f9f5e1:22

value
2662497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ffd43454d5595351ae4885a7044fd99ec90539 OP_EQUAL
address
3FjHnCVovXiK1dox1Zw58LCWxQMUYXwybb
transaction
621f7c0583a4a429a7665e0a9cd2a10837808da2c6ea75b65de15c0ed2f9f5e1
spent
true